NEWTON'S THIRD LAW  OF MOTION

Newton's thrid law of motion states that for every action force there is an equal but opposite reaction force. Hence, the law means that whenever a force is applied, it must generate a reaction force which is equal in magnitude of the applied force but it must have the direction that is opposite to the direction of the applied force.

In part C the force applied by the wheel barrow on the ground is its weight. And as a reaction force the ground applies a normal force on the wheelbarrow with equal magnitude as the weight.
